American Jessica Pegula, ranked fourth in the world, has advanced to the final of the Berlin tennis tournament after defeating Belarusian Aryna Sabalenka, the top seed, in three sets. Pegula secured the match with scores of 6-2, 6-7 (4-7), and 6-0 in a game that lasted two hours and 13 minutes. She will face the winner of the later match between Nuskova and Iala. This is Pegula's second time reaching the Berlin final, and it marks her fourth victory over Sabalenka, taking advantage of her opponent's mistakes.
